Re: Aq131A Video Please Help

so im not thinking straight, if i line up all the lines on the timing belt with the pullys, im good to go right? i know theres a compression and exhaust stroke for the crank but it still is the same as long as it lines up... im so tired of tinkering its rediculous... any advice would rock...

That is correct. The belt supposedly has a double line on it to line with the mark on the crank. Intermediate and cam have a single line on the belt.

So is the problem the crank keeps turning as you try to loosen the bolt. If you have a strap wrench you can try putting it on the pulley to hold it.

sqbtr

Senior Chief Petty Officer
Joined
Feb 23, 2010
Messages
716
Re: Aq131A Video Please Help

If it has started to move, soak the back side with a mix of acetone and ATF. Push it back on and keep working it in and out. I would take a close look at the raw water pump for leaks out the rear seal if the balancer is that hard to pull.

Re: Aq131A Video Please Help

Sounds like about all you can do now is cut it off and get a new one. I would take a reciprocating saw and cut away about 1/3 of the pulley down to the center hub of the pulley which is in contact with the crank. Then I would use a fiber cut off wheel in a dremel tool to cut away an area of the center hub of the pulley down to the crank. The pulley should then seperate enough at the cut to be loose and come off. By looking at the picture #288 on page 91 in the manual it doesn't look like it's really on the shaft that far. I've cut bearing races like this before with dremel tools to get them off shafts.
